Transaction 5420f1c98dd4a1d0c8aaa1aa971f9f1bbb84c238d95d0081e5e1d9b6e2bfde9c
2 Input
1 Outputs
- 5420f1c98dd4a1d0c8aaa1aa971f9f1bbb84c238d95d0081e5e1d9b6e2bfde9c:0
value 14610691
address 31zMPTmWchu4La3MhkNvzAvsB3YiJRGNKR